PTA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2021 in Review
40 of the 6,498 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Cohen & Steers Tax-Advantaged Preferred Securities & Income Fund (PTA) for Q4 2021, worth a combined $204M — up 83% from $112M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 22 funds opened new PTA positions and 3 closed out — a net gain of 19 holders — while 12 added to existing stakes and 3 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Rivernorth Capital Management, adding an estimated $45.7M. The largest seller was Morgan Stanley, cutting an estimated $512K.
